Output 128523d84e96b6628e9dbabe38a0708816098dc465889277c7576dc54dcfc901:1

value
16614640
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eef2c64cfdae56e23f87d78dbf4419c3e75611a6 OP_EQUAL
address
3PUTaUWkEzVYLURoUkVvwNVfc7c1RVGDE5
transaction
128523d84e96b6628e9dbabe38a0708816098dc465889277c7576dc54dcfc901
confirmations
60646
spent
true